‘There’s always a buzz around the FA Cup’ – Allen.

The Robins travel to The People’s Pension Stadium on Sunday (April 18th) to take on Brighton and Hove Albion in the Fourth Round of the Vitality Women’s FA Cup.

Allen believes the squad can draw on their experiences in reaching the FA Continental Cup Final earlier this season as they aim to progress to the next round.

“Everyone is really relishing it,” she said. “It’s a great opportunity for us to progress in another cup competition this year.

“We’ve tasted what it is like in getting to the Conti Cup Final this year and that’s an exciting journey and we want to go further in this competition, and it starts on Sunday against Brighton.

“There are four big games left for us and everyone has come back in ready to work with a smile on our faces.

“We’re in good place at the moment and hopefully the momentum will take us through in these last three games – a win on Sunday would kickstart an important period for us.

“There is always a buzz around the FA Cup as a player because it is such an exciting competition. We’d love to get an FA Cup run going and like Matt (Beard) has been saying to us, it’s an opportunity for us to go out and express ourselves.

“It’s a knockout game, you’ve got to win to progress, so come Sunday we’ll be giving 110% to ensure we can progress.”

The full-back is wary that the Seagulls are a transformed team compared to the one they convincingly beat 3-0 back in January, however she believes City have also developed making Sunday’s match-up all the more exciting.

She added: “Brighton have had some really good results since we last played them. They’re going to be a completely different team to the one we faced before, they have some good players and they’re in form but we’re up for the challenge.

“We’re also in a good place right now as a group, our togetherness is second to none and we’ll fight for each other which we will show on Sunday.”
